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,476 in Kongsvinger versus $2,791 in Trondheim.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,749 in Kongsvinger versus $4,121 in Trondheim.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$5,022 in Kongsvinger versus $5,452 in Trondheim.

Living in Kongsvinger costs roughly 11% less than in Trondheim,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Kongsvinger 85% above, Trondheim 109% above.
